WebAnna's Hummingbird is an extremely vocal species, especially for a hummingbird. Males sing a buzzy, scratchy-sounding song while perched and during their high-flying courtship spectacles. During the display, the … WebJul 29, 2024 · Anna's Hummingbirds, are larger with a less hunched posture than Costa's. When perched, the tail of Anna's extends farther past the wings than it does on Costa's Hummingbirds. The gorget and crown on male Anna's shines red rather than purple. © …

Web4-4.5 g. Length. 10-11 cm. Wingspan. 114-121 mm. Anna's hummingbird ( Calypte anna ) is a medium-sized bird species of the family Trochilidae. It was named after Anna Masséna, Duchess of Rivoli. It is native to western coastal regions of North America. In the early 20th century, Anna's hummingbirds bred only in northern Baja California and ... Bright purple feathers drape across the throat of male Costa's Hummingbirds, sticking out wildly to each side, like an overgrown mustache. Males show off their purple colors for females, which are dressed in green with a pale eyebrow and a whitish belly.
